Dry port plays increasingly an important role in the integration of inland regions with seaports, and cross-border inland ports especially in the context of Belt and Road Initiative (BRI) originally proposed by China. This paper studies a logistics network connecting the inland regions by dry ports based on a two-stage logistical gravity model. First, a basic logistical gravity model is developed to analyze the radiated inland regions from dry ports, where the logistical quality of dry ports is calculated by principal component analysis. Second, considering mutual impacts among dry ports, seaports and cross-border inland ports, the influence of logistical gravity on the network is examined by using a coefficient based on the Ordered Weighted Averaging Operator in multi-attribute decision theory. An improved logistical gravity model is further developed to investigate the logistical connections among various ports (e.g. dry ports, seaports and cross-border inland ports; hub and feeder ports). Then, a hub-and-spoke network can be established. Dry ports are potential to connect to the Silk Road Economic Belt and the 21st-Century Maritime Silk Road. So a Chinese case is used to verify the proposed method. The strategies of embedding inland regions in the BRI are discussed based on the experimental studies.  相似文献
